Overview of Commission Calculation Outsourcing Market
The Commission Calculation Outsourcing market encompasses specialized services that handle the computation, validation, and management of sales commissions across diverse industries. These services include automated calculation platforms, data integration, compliance checks, and reporting solutions tailored to client-specific commission structures. Core offerings focus on reducing manual errors, enhancing transparency, and streamlining complex compensation processes, thereby enabling organizations to optimize sales incentives and ensure regulatory compliance.
Key end-use industries include banking and financial services, insurance, telecommunications, retail, and manufacturing. These sectors rely heavily on accurate commission calculations to motivate sales teams, manage large volumes of transactional data, and adhere to evolving regulatory standards. The importance of this market in the global economy is underscored by its role in supporting sales performance management, reducing operational costs, and fostering trust through transparent compensation practices. As organizations increasingly digitize and automate, the demand for outsourced commission calculation services continues to grow, underpinning strategic business objectives worldwide.
